Theresa E. Keves Biography
Theresa Elaine Keves is an Independent Non-Attorney Professional Mediator, Talk Show Host, Hearing Officer and Virtual Business Director. She is the 5th child out of six children born to two loving, hard working, spirited individuals.
With a combination of more than 37 years in the legal field and the corporate arena, Theresa is extremely passionate, logical and loyal about her career in Business and Professional Mediation. A kind, caring, insightful and trustworthy individual, she is certainly at her best when she is helping those who want and need her assistance, which attributes to the high commitment that she has with the specialized services she offers, in her mediation practice.
Theresa has become a talk show host (TalkZone.com) for her own internet radio program, titled “Put It All On The Table Through Mediation.” It airs bi-weekly, on Thursdays at 8 am MST (please check for your local listing). The premise of this show is to not only have great conversations about the practice of mediation; but, to educate, inform, enlighten/inspire the general public about the great benefits that are contained within the mediation process.
An advocate for education, she has a Bachelor of Science in Business Management, a Master in Business Administration and Technology Management. Theresa has a Professional Certificate in Mediation from the University of Phoenix and a Professional Certificate in Mediating The Litigated Case, from Pepperdine University School of Law, Washington, D.C. Theresa hears Small Claims cases/Civil Traffic cases for the Justice Courts. She is a Volunteer Mediator for the Attorney General Office – Civil Rights Division, where recently she boasts 100% case resolution.
She also volunteers her time to train high school students for Peer Mediation and assisted in training other prospecting mediators for the Attorney General Office.
